Since Taal Volcano's reawakening last week, there has been renewed interest in its past eruptions. Circulating on social media is the documentary on its 1965 eruption and some passages from the book "The Mysteries of Taal" by Thomas Hargrove, which was published just months after the devastating 1991 Pinatubo eruption.

Finally, on November 28, ash columns “ascended higher than ever before” “accompanied by terrific lightning and thunder above, and violent shocks of earthquake underneath.” Volcanic tsunamis flooded lakeshore houses and on November 29, houses collapsed from the weight of ash, mud and water. There were also shock waves or blasts of changing atmospheric pressure in Talisay and San Nicolas, which were felt like a strong wind coming from the volcano.
